Cubic Foot Warmer Late 18th, Openwork Dutch Dinanderie
Artist: Dinanderie De Dinand
Cubic shaped brass foot warmer slightly domed and openwork top with engraved floral decoration and carrying handle. 4 sides identical, hammered with a large convex cabochon mirror effect, in borders with threads of pearls and tulips. One side opens with butterfly ring to place the iron bucket containing embers, which we don't have. Beautiful object!
The underside bears a lightly engraved mark: owner's initials and date: 1797.
Size: 19cm x 19cm x 16cm. Used at the time, in the 18th century in carriages, churches with long offices, to bathe beds... Take a good look at our photos.....
Good general condition, except for bottom, which has lost its ball feet on corners, one corner is also torn, (photo with red arrows). Take a good look at our photos.
